A mild oxidative decarboxylation of carbohydrate acids

The oxidative decarboxylation of carbohydrate uronic or ulosonic acids with simultaneous replacement by an acetoxy group has been accomplished using the (diacetoxyiodo)benzene and iodine system under mild conditions. A general synthesis of derivatives of tetrodialdoses, and pentodialdoses in furanose or pyranose form is described.
